(LAKEWOOD RANCH, FL) - After just one game in the district tournament, the Lakewood Ranch High School (LRHS) Mustangs baseball season is over. The team played at Parrish Community High School and suffered a 6-2 defeat.
The first season under Head Coach Ian Desmond was a memorable one, as the team went 7-15 and lost to some of the most challenging teams in the state.

Varsity players gave their opinions on the season.
Junior Dax Moskowitz said, “Season was one of my favorites, Demond is a really great coach.”
Junior Jake Lefevre said, “At first my playing time was almost nonexistent, then when I got my opportunity, I was able to make an impact on this team.”
The team had memorable victories over Riverview, Palmetto, Southeast, and Lake Placid. Overall, it was a memorable season and a good start to the Desmond Era of Lakewood Ranch Baseball.
